Canterbury, a beautiful medieval town founded by the Romans, is home to the world’s most famous cathedral and is also home to two universities. It is the capital of Kent, a region often called “the Garden of England”, dotted with medieval castles, gardens and small and characteristic coastal towns.

The city has plenty of cafes, pubs, clubs and modern shopping malls. It has excellent connections to London, Dover and the English Channel. Here you can fully taste the true English Style, and see the beautiful English houses typical from this part of England. 

The friendliness of its inhabitants, the scenic shops that follow each other in the picturesque streets of the centre makes the perfect destination for your school group mini-stays.

Cambridge Exam Preparation

If your students are already preparing themselves for the Cambridge Exam, this will be a good option to study it during your ministay. We can only take closed groups for this course and all the students need to be studying towards the same exam. For example, if your school group is of 30 students we may split the group into 2 smaller groups and offer them a course accordingly to their exam level. It will be possible to prepare for four different levels of Cambridge exam: Preliminary English Test (PET), First Certificate of English (FCE), Certificate in Advanced English (CAE), or Certificate of Proficiency in English (CPE). Our course will help your students to acquire the skills necessary to pass the exam and understand the exam structure and marks. If it is required we may simulate a typical exam day during their stay so that they will get the feeling of what will be expected during the exam.

Academic English

If you think that for your ministays your students may be interested in attending a course other then General English, we can offer the option to attend an academic English course instead. The aim of the course is to prepare the learners for advanced language skills needed to attend high education Institutions such as Universities. During the course, the pupils will discuss a wide variety of topics in order to improve their accuracy and fluency. They will also read an academic text, for example, a journal article that will develop their understanding skills. The focus will be also on academic writing such as taking notes and on the academic way of writing sentences structures. This course is for school groups that have at least a B2 level.

Residential Accommodation

We have the availability of residential accommodation all year round, our type of accommodation varies depending on your budget and requirements. We can offer students residence accommodation with students staying in two or three per room with shared or private facilities, hotel or B&B accommodation with students staying in triple or family rooms with private facilities. If you would like to choose this option for your students but your budget is very limited, we will be able to offer hostel accommodation. Most of our hostels are 4 stars with students staying in multiple rooms of 4,6 and sometimes 8 students in a room with private facilities, but we have also budget hostels where students will be staying in larger rooms with or without an en-suite room. We will organise for you, breakfast and dinner if this is required. Most of our residential accommodation is situated in the city centre or not far from it, but please bear in mind that availability may be limited, therefore, for this option, we may require an advance booking.
